The Young and the Restless Spoilers Next 2 Weeks: Victor’s Irresistible Offer – Summer Leaves Lauren – Kyle Seeks Phyllis’ Help

The Young and the Restless (Y&R) spoilers for the next two weeks, June 21 to July 2, tease that Victor Newman (Eric Braeden) will make an irresistible offer while Summer Newman (Hunter King) leaves Lauren Baldwin (Tracey E. Bregman) scrambling and Kyle Abbott (Michael Mealor) seeks Phyllis Summers’ (Michelle Stafford) help.

During the week of June 21-25, Billy Abbott (Jason Thompson) will decide it’s time to confront Ashland Locke (Richard Burgi) and deliver a warning.

Billy will likely insist that although he’s not a couple with Victoria Newman (Amelia Heinle) anymore, he still cares about her and will fight back if someone dares to hurt her.

Of course, Ashland won’t be scared of Billy or anything else for that matter since he’s only got about six months to live. He may be more amused than anything and just urge Billy to let Victoria fight her own battles.

Victoria is more than capable of taking care of herself and in fact has a plan to merge Newman Enterprises with Locke Communications Group. Ashland will get on board with that plan and start working out the details with Victoria soon enough.

Meanwhile, Amanda Sinclair (Mishael Morgan) will uncover some new secrets that leave her rattled.

Despite Naya Benedict’s (Ptosha Storey) claims about cutting off contact with Richard Nealon and avoiding his calls, she indeed had a five-minute phone conversation with him. There’ll be phone record evidence of it, so Amanda will be thrown for a loop.

Amanda will give Naya one more chance to come clean, but Naya won’t take it. That’ll lead to Amanda catching Naya in the lie and confronting her with the proof. Naya won’t react well to Amanda’s accusations, so this could turn into quite a faceoff.

As if that wasn’t enough, these phone records will prove Richard repeatedly contacted Sutton Ames’ (Jack Landron) campaign office before his murder.

Amanda will be fed up with all the lies she’s been fed and will become even more convinced that she has to find out the whole truth.

Other Y&R spoilers say Summer will face more threats from Tara Locke (Elizabeth Leiner), so she’ll have an agonizing decision to make.

Summer can either dump Kyle and take a new job in Italy or risk letting Tara take Harrison Locke (Kellen Enriquez) away from Kyle forever.

Lauren will face a tough blow that leaves her scrambling, so it sounds like Summer will turn in her resignation.

It looks like Phyllis will learn at least part of the story and face off with Tara, but Tara won’t back down when it comes to what she wants.

Kyle will eventually turn to Phyllis for assistance, so he may think Summer’s mom can talk her out of leaving town.

Kyle will be desperate to save his future with Summer and make sense of her weird behavior, but Summer won’t want to do anything that would rock the boat with Tara and make him lose his son.

As for Abby Newman-Abbott-Chancellor (Melissa Ordway), she’ll get a blast from the past when a familiar face reappears. We’ve heard rumblings that Ben “Stitch” Rayburn (Sean Carrigan) might pop up again, so we’ll see if he’s the unexpected return she faces.

During the week of June 28-July 2, Jack Abbott (Peter Bergman) will have to rein Billy in. He’ll sense the potential for trouble, so he’ll do his best to save Billy from himself!

In the meantime, Victor will have an offer for Adam Newman (Mark Grossman) – one that proves too tempting for Adam to turn down.

Perhaps Victor will present a Billy revenge plan that’s too enticing for Adam to reject this time around. As for Nikki Newman (Melody Thomas Scott), she’ll grill Victoria about her intentions.

Nikki may get updates on the merger Victoria has pitched to Ashland and worry Victoria’s getting in over her head here.

Back with Kyle, he’ll get a difficult lesson about love. Someone will be tough on Kyle to prove a point, so maybe Jack or someone else will push him to respect Summer’s wishes.

They won’t realize Summer’s simply under Tara’s control and has been backed into a corner.
